搭建一个高效的程序开发环境是每位程序员在开始工作之前必须面对的任务。一个良好的开发环境不仅能提高开发效率,减少bug的产生,还能让程序员在编写代码时更加专注和享受。无论你是刚入行的学生,还是经验丰富的开发者,掌握搭建开发环境的技能都是至关重要的。本文将详细介绍如何一步步搭建一个理想的开发环境,从选择合适的操作系统,到安装必要的软件和工具,让你的开发旅程更加顺畅。

选择合适的操作系统是搭建开发环境的第一步。根据开发的需求,可以选择Windows、macOS或Linux。每种操作系统都有其优缺点,比如Windows兼容性好,适合大多数软件开发;而Linux则是服务器开发的首选,开源且自由度高。根据你要开发的项目类型,选择最适合的操作系统至关重要。
接下来,安装开发工具是提升开发效率的关键。集成开发环境(IDE)如Visual Studio、Eclipse或IntelliJ IDEA等,可以大大简化代码编写、调试和测试的过程。根据你的编程语言选择合适的IDE,并加入必要的插件,以增强功能。命令行工具也是不可或缺的,它能让你更加高效地完成一些重复性工作。
第三步,配置版本控制系统。当前软件开发离不开版本控制,Git是最流行的选择。通过Git不仅可以跟踪代码的变化,还能方便地与团队成员协作。你可以在GitHub或GitLab上创建代码仓库,这样既能备份代码,又能方便分享和交流。
安装必要的编程语言和框架也是不可忽视的一环。根据你选择的开发方向,安装相应的编程语言环境,如Python、Java或JavaScript等,并配置好相应的框架和库。确保你所需的所有依赖项都已正确安装,以避免在开发过程中遇到各种环境问题。
完善开发环境的配置。包括调整代码格式、设置编码规范和常用工具的快捷键,为开发达到最佳状态提供支持。推荐使用一些代码规范检查工具,如ESLint或Prettier,保持代码的整洁和一致性。
搭建一个理想的程序开发环境需要从选择操作系统、安装开发工具,到配置版本控制和编程语言环境等多个方面进行。每一步都是为了提升开发效率和确保代码质量。在实践中不断调整和优化你的开发环境,将帮助你在程序开发的道路上走得更加顺利。
